Development

Similar to other
ascomycota Ascomycota is a phylum of the kingdom Fungi that, together with the Basidiomycota, forms the subkingdom Dikarya. Its members are commonly known as the sac fungi or ascomycetes. It is the largest phylum of Fungi, with over 64,000 species. The def ...
, the lifecycle of ''M. rhizophila'' is split into two parts: the sexual and asexual stages. The sexual lifestage is characterized by a globose (400-500 um wide) fruit-like body that contains the sexual spores, called a
perithecia An ascocarp, or ascoma (: ascomata), is the fruiting body ( sporocarp) of an ascomycete phylum fungus. It consists of very tightly interwoven hyphae and millions of embedded asci, each of which typically contains four to eight ascospores. Ascoc ...
, which occurs in either singles or multiples. Perithecia are flask-like shaped and contain asci, which are septated,
unitunicate An ascus (; : asci) is the sexual spore-bearing cell produced in ascomycete fungi. Each ascus usually contains eight ascospores (or octad), produced by meiosis followed, in most species, by a mitotic cell division. However, asci in some gener ...
stalks of 8
ascospore In fungi, an ascospore is the sexual spore formed inside an ascus—the sac-like cell that defines the division Ascomycota, the largest and most diverse Division (botany), division of fungi. After two parental cell nucleus, nuclei fuse, the ascu ...
s. The ascospores are biseriate, fusiform, and slightly curved or helical when naive. The perithecia is lined with cells called the peridium and has accessory structures called periphyses and paraphyses that surround the outside and inside of the structure, respectively. Paraphyses inside the perithecia dissolve once asci reach maturity. The asexual lifestage is characterized by asexual conidial structures (6-20x2-6 um).
Conidiophores A conidium ( ; : conidia), sometimes termed an asexual chlamydospore or chlamydoconidium (: chlamydoconidia), is an asexual, non- motile spore of a fungus. The word ''conidium'' comes from the Ancient Greek word for dust, ('). They are also ...
are either simple or branched.
Compared to the fruiting bodies of other Magnaporthe species, ''rhizophila'' is considered faster growing (0.8 cm/d at 28 °C) with slightly longer and wider conidial cells.
''M. rhizophila'' is
homothallic In fungi and algae, homothallism refers to the condition in which a single individual or thallus carries the genetic determinants (i.e., both mating types or sexes) required to undergo sexual reproduction without the need for a distinct mating partn ...
, so it is self-fertile and can mate with similar mating types within its own mycelia.


Ecology

''Magnaporthe rhizophila'' is considered a
necrotrophic A fungus (: fungi , , , or ; or funguses) is any member of the group of eukaryotic organisms that includes microorganisms such as yeasts and molds, as well as the more familiar mushrooms. These organisms are classified as one of the traditi ...
parasite Parasitism is a Symbiosis, close relationship between species, where one organism, the parasite, lives (at least some of the time) on or inside another organism, the Host (biology), host, causing it some harm, and is Adaptation, adapted str ...
because it relies on the nutrients and support of other organisms to thrive. It is a
heterotroph A heterotroph (; ) is an organism that cannot produce its own food, instead taking nutrition from other sources of organic carbon, mainly plant or animal matter. In the food chain, heterotrophs are primary, secondary and tertiary consumers, but ...
since it is unequipped to sequester energy on its own, hence its symbiotic behavior. Magnaporthacaea are family-specific soil-borne parasites of
Gramineae Poaceae ( ), also called Gramineae ( ), is a large and nearly ubiquitous family of monocotyledonous flowering plants commonly known as grasses. It includes the cereal grasses, bamboos, the grasses of natural grassland and species cultivated i ...
; ''rhizophila'' specifically colonizes the roots of millet.
Spores from ''M. rhizophila'' are dispersed by natural manners such as wind, water, and animals. These spores then settle in soil where they grow and mature through asexual life cycles until it is optimal for the hyphae to resume a sexual cycle and a host organism is near. ''Rhizophila'' is only root-infecting; however many of its Magnaporthe relatives are both soil and aerial-infecting. The fungus has an
appressorium An appressorium is a specialized cell typical of many fungal plant pathogens that is used to infect host plants. It is a flattened, hyphal "pressing" organ, from which a minute infection peg grows and enters the host, using turgor pressure capable ...
structure which functions to elicit
effector Effector may refer to: *Effector (biology), a molecule that binds to a protein and thereby alters the activity of that protein * ''Effector'' (album), a music album by the Experimental Techno group Download * ''EFFector'', a publication of the El ...
hormones to increase host susceptibility (2 clade-specific types of small specific proteins (SSP) ). Lignitubers have been considered a response by host cells after infection as a response to fungal invasion. However, ''rhizophila'' kills host cells in 5–6 weeks.
''M. rhizophila'' has darkly pigmented
hypha A hypha (; ) is a long, branching, filamentous structure of a fungus, oomycete, or actinobacterium. In most fungi, hyphae are the main mode of vegetative growth, and are collectively called a mycelium. Structure A hypha consists of one o ...
e, composing
mycelia Mycelium (: mycelia) is a root-like structure of a fungus consisting of a mass of branching, thread-like hyphae. Its normal form is that of branched, slender, entangled, anastomosing, hyaline threads. Fungal colonies composed of mycelium are fo ...
that has a gray-brown color, darker than species in the rest of its family. It is able to be cultured in vitro and survives on PDA (potato dextrose agar) plates.

Genetics

From data derived from
genetic testing Genetic testing, also known as DNA testing, is used to identify changes in DNA sequence or chromosome structure. Genetic testing can also include measuring the results of genetic changes, such as RNA analysis as an output of gene expression, or ...
, it was found that ''M. rhizophila'' originated in South Africa. Fungal fossils demonstrated that the phyla diverged 31 million years ago from other
Sordariomycetes Sordariomycetes is a class of fungi in the subdivision Pezizomycotina (Ascomycota). It is the second-largest class of Ascomycota, with a worldwide distribution that mostly accommodates terrestrial based taxa, although several can also be found in ...
, and the
phylogeny A phylogenetic tree or phylogeny is a graphical representation which shows the evolutionary history between a set of species or Taxon, taxa during a specific time.Felsenstein J. (2004). ''Inferring Phylogenies'' Sinauer Associates: Sunderland, M ...
diverged 21 million years ago from
pezizomycotina Pezizomycotina is the largest subdivision of Ascomycota, containing the filamentous ascomycetes and most lichenized fungi. It is more or less synonymous with the older taxon Euascomycota. These fungi reproduce by fission rather than budding. Thi ...
.
Magnaporthe species are grouped into three divergent
clade In biology, a clade (), also known as a Monophyly, monophyletic group or natural group, is a group of organisms that is composed of a common ancestor and all of its descendants. Clades are the fundamental unit of cladistics, a modern approach t ...
s; rhizophila is in clade classification D along with ''M. poae'' and ''G. incrustans''. ''Rhizophila'' belongs to the Magnaporthe family based on its ascospore morphology; however, it has been considered for the ''
Gaeumannomyces ''Gaeumannomyces'' is a genus of fungi in the family Magnaporthaceae. Species *''Gaeumannomyces amomi'' *''Gaeumannomyces caricis'' *''Gaeumannomyces cylindrosporus'' *''Gaeumannomyces graminis'' **''Gaeumannomyces graminis var. avenae'' **'' Gae ...
'' because they also produce
phialophora ''Phialophora'' is a form genus of fungus with short conidiophores, sometimes reduced to phialides; their conidia are unicellular. They may be parasites (including on humans), or saprophytic (including on apples). Genetic analysis of ''Phialop ...
-like
anamorphs In mycology, the terms teleomorph, anamorph, and holomorph apply to portions of the life cycles of fungi in the phyla Ascomycota and Basidiomycota: *Teleomorph: the sexual reproductive stage (morph), typically a fruiting body. *Anamorph: an asex ...
instead of
sympodial In botany, sympodial growth is a bifurcating branching pattern where one branch develops more strongly than the other, resulting in the stronger branches forming the primary shoot and the weaker branches appearing laterally. A sympodium, als ...
pyricularia. ''M. rhizophila'' is the only known Magnaporthe species with a phialophora anamorph. Given these similarities between families, ''M. rhizophila'' is highly hybridized with other species among these groups.
The ''M. rhizophila'' genome is composed of 5.8%
transposable element A transposable element (TE), also transposon, or jumping gene, is a type of mobile genetic element, a nucleic acid sequence in DNA that can change its position within a genome. The discovery of mobile genetic elements earned Barbara McClinto ...
s, lower than other species in its family.
